If the cremated remains are to be given to the applicant, and the applicant does not take them within a reasonable time, the cremation authority must give 14 days’ notice to the applicant of its intention to dispose of the cremated remains before it disposes of them. The ashes of an average cremated human weighs 5 pounds The cremated remains of an adult male usually weighs around 6 pounds while the remains of an adult female will be closer to 4 pounds.
